We have a 2011 3.8 Premium w/Premium Nav...
I know I had seen the tilt down mirror function that lower the mirrors when the car is in reverse listed as a feature, and I swore that I had even seen it work, but I had begun to doubt the feature existed, because it was not definitely not working in since we first took delivery of the car in February....
Yesterday,I had adjusted the driver's mirror a bit and stored the new position in the seat memory and ,lo and behold, after that the mirror tilted down in reverse???
My Wife called me this morning and was excited to discover that the mirror tilt function was working...I explained to her what I had done and with a bit more investigating she figured out that this feature ONLY works if the mirror adjustment selector switch on the door (for selecting which mirror is adjusted) is in the LEFT or RIGHT position. The feature is disabled when the switch is in the center position...normally you would want to return it to the center to prevent accidental adjustment, but I had inadvertently left it in the LEFT position and by chance "enabled" the tilt feature....
